Abstract

A series of rare-earth oxides LaxCe1-xCuMn/γ-Al2O3 supported catalysts were prepared by impregnation methods. Taking CO and C3H8 oxidation as a probe reaction, the different x values and active component loadings on the catalyst for CO and C3H8 oxidation were investigated. The experimental results demonstrate that the catalysts (x=0.4 and amount of active component=15.04 %) have a lower light-off temperature, and the CO and C3H8 conversion is a bove 99%. These catalysts were characterized by means of XRD, TEM and BET tec hniques to verify the species present in the catalysts. The results show that this catalyst has a high surface area, and the size of the active component is much smaller than nanoscale, and is highly dispersed on the nano-fibrous γ-Al2O3.
